Arena statement: "We will now be parting ways with bassist Ian Salmon. Many thanks for the last ten years Ian, and good luck for the future.

Returning to the band - We are happy to welcome back Mr John Jowitt on Bass.
Good luck to both of them!!!

Arena Line up
Mick Pointer
Clive Nolan
John Mitchell
Paul Manzi
John Jowitt
